By. admin. -. Sep 6, 2006. 6139. SMART-T is a MILSTAR satellite-compatible communications terminal mounted on a High Mobility Multi-Purpose Wheeled Vehicle (HMMWV). The AEHF payload consists of processors, antennas, radio frequency subsystems and crosslinks.
